England Banned Shock Collars, Here’s Why That Could Be Sad News #214
Visit us at shapedbydog.com    England has banned using remote electric shock collars on dogs starting from February 2024. Why do I find this sad if shock collars aren’t tools I use or advocate? And why is the term “shock collar” offensive to some who use them? I’m covering both questions, why many people will be upset with me about my thoughts on the e-collar ban and alternate solutions for people and dogs.   In the episode you'll hear:   • The pros and cons of England’s ban on e-collars. • Why the term “shock collar” triggers some dog trainers. • The three groups of people who use shock collars and why. • Why shocking dogs for ‘bad’ behaviors is not a solution. • That one of the biggest pet store chains in North America stopped selling e-Collars. • That banning one punishment device could make an even worse one popular. • How the way we choose to train dogs relates to the stories we tell ourselves. • The ways people try to manage their dog’s behavior and justifications for e-Collar use. • My curiosity as to why some elite dog sports competitors are still using shock collars. • How the positive reinforcement dog training community can advocate through education.   Resources:   1. Solve Your Dog's Separation Anxiety With FRIDA: Expanding Calm With Functional Relaxation #200
Visit us at shapedbydog.com    If you've ever owned or seen a dog who suffers from separation anxiety, you know how heartbreaking that can be. I'm sharing a 10-step protocol that will turn the dog training world on its head because it's like nothing that is out there for separation anxiety help. It's the FRIDA Protocol created by two of my European students, who are amazing dog trainers, Nadine Hehli and Simone Fasel, to help their rescue dog Frida with her extreme separation anxiety. The protocol is now helping many more dogs, and I'm bringing you the steps to overcoming canine separation anxiety for our special 200th episode of Shaped by Dog.   In the episode you'll hear:   • A case study of Nadine and Simone's rescue dog, Frida, who overcame severe separation anxiety. • Why typical approaches to separation anxiety don't work for extreme cases. • The 10 steps of the FRIDA Protocol to help dogs with separation anxiety. • What equipment you'll need to get started, including a snuffle mat and remote feeder. • The foundations for success with the FRIDA Protocol. • Why functional relaxation to create calm for dogs is a critical component. • Reminders about the body language of calm dogs vs. anxious dogs. • When and how to introduce remote feeders and WiFi cameras to work through separation anxiety. • How to begin fading in barriers that allow the dog freedom of movement in their "Fortress of Calm". • When to introduce "Hidden Treasures" for your dog. • Why remote feeders aren't babysitters. • When and how to leave your dog home alone for the first time. • How to create calm relaxation for your dog in other places like the car.   Separation Anxiety Online Program: Register your interest in having Nadine and Simone’s Online Program for Separation Anxiety in English - https://dogsthat.com/separation-anxiety/   Dog Gear Mentioned for the FRIDA Protocol: *West Paw Toppl Treat Toys - https://geni.us/toppl *Snuffle Mat - https://geni.us/snuffle_mat *Bowser Donut Dog Bed - https://geni.us/bowser-bed *Ex-Pen - https://geni.us/ex-pen-white *PetGeek Remote Feeder - https://geni.us/petgeek-dispenser *Treat & Train Remote Feeder - https://geni.us/treat-train *Ring Stick Up Cam - https://geni.us/ring-stick-up-cam Kong Toys - https://www.kongcompany.com/   Resources:   1. Puppy Fear Periods: Help For Socializing Puppies Or Rescue Dogs Scared Of People #199
Visit us at shapedbydog.com    Most puppies go through a ‘Fear Period’ stage, which can include fear of objects, adults, children, and other dogs. Unfortunately, many popular strategies taught to counter puppy fear are the absolute worst things possible. I’m covering three things you should never do when your puppy or rescue dog displays fear of people and what to do instead to create confident and empowered dogs.   In the episode you'll hear:   • The bad advice given when puppies show fear of people. • What 'flooding' is and why it intensifies fears. • The 3E's of Environment, Education and Empowerment for puppy and rescue dog socializing. • About empowering your dog with choice vs. controlling them. • Cues and games that grow confidence for puppies and dogs. • How to use a distinct noise to refocus a puppy's attention when they're worried. • Ways to change the environment easily by changing your appearance. • How to set up "training dens" in your home and increase confidence for puppies or rescue dogs. • What body language looks like for confident and joyful dogs. • How to manage and train in environments with potential fear triggers for your dog. • What to do when you have houseguests that your dog or puppy fears.   Shaped by Dog Episode 200 Online Celebration Event: Register to get the news to join us for an online party for Episode 200! - https://dogsthat.com/sbd-celebrate-episode-200/   Learn to Play ItsYerChoice: https://recallers.com/iycsummit-join   Resources:   1. Outsmarting Distractions: How To Use Environmental Reinforcement in Dog Training #197
Visit us at shapedbydog.com    The expression about Vegas casinos that “the house always wins” is like the one about dog training: The environment always wins. But it doesn’t have to be true when you learn to use the  environment to your advantage. Mastering reinforcement means understanding what your dog values most, and there are many things dogs value. Once you know where the reinforcement is for your dog, you can build yourself into that reinforcement so that it is you, not the environment, winning your dog’s focus.   In the episode you'll hear:   • The role environments play in your dog’s reinforcers. • How “jackpot” dopamine creates value for dogs. • How a negative prediction error encourages dogs to repeat and escalate behavior. • Where counter surfing really starts (and it’s not at the counter). • Why you need to be aware of the thing before the thing. • How to neutralize distracting environments to win your dog’s focus. • Why training puppies and dogs in the bathroom is ideal in the beginning. • How to grow the environment in your dog training. • What to do when you know your dog will ignore you, with the example of playing with other dogs. • Why and when to give your dog surprise high value rewards. • Tips for building yourself into all the reinforcement your dog receives.   Shaped by Dog Episode 200 Online Celebration Event Register to get the news to join us for an online party for Episode 200! https://dogsthat.com/sbd-celebrate-episode-200/   Resources:   1.
